iPhone 5 First Impressions

Hi all,

So, my new iPhone has been delivered and everything is set up! I'm one of those lucky Aussies who live in the future :P

Anyway, I'm pretty impressed with this pocket beast! It is certainly a lot quicker than my iPhone 4.

The screen size is noticeably taller. The change in aspect ratio feels good. The lack of increase in width seems awkward in photos, but when you hold it you understand how much more comfortable it feels when compared to a wider phone. The dock is so tiny now! I almost missed it when checking out the bottom of the device. The speaker grills also look great in the finished modal. They do not appear as large as photos portray them to be.

Here are a couple photos of the message app...it does lend more room. However, I'm not a fan of the landscape keyboard set up.

I'm at work so not near my macbook for a material comparison. The brushed Al on the back of the phone has a silver colour but seems slightly smoother than my mid 2010 MBP. The cut edges are highly glossed and look very cool next to the white face. The white bands separating the antennas is a nice touch also.
